Why These Are the Top Audi Repair Auto Repair Shops in Walling

** The Audi repair market for residents of Walling, Tennessee, is almost entirely dependent on specialists located in the greater Nashville area, approximately a 60-90 minute drive. Due to Walling's rural nature, there are no local specialists. The market in the serving region (Nashville) is competitive and of high quality, featuring several independent shops with strong reputations that provide a viable and often preferred alternative to the local Audi dealership. These specialists typically offer labor rates 20-30% lower than the dealership while providing equivalent or superior technical expertise for older models. Pricing is consistent with major metropolitan areas; a standard service (e.g., oil change) may range from $150-$250, while more complex repairs like DSG service or turbo replacement can cost $1,500 to $4,000+. For Walling residents, the primary consideration is the travel time to Nashville, which is compensated for by the access to expert-level service not available locally.

When should I seek service for my Audi's warning lights instead of trying to drive to a city like Cookeville or McMinnville?

Seek immediate local service for critical warnings like the red oil pressure or coolant temperature lights, as driving could cause severe engine damage. For less urgent yellow lights (like check engine), it's still best to have a local specialist diagnose it promptly to avoid being stranded on rural routes like Highway 30 or 285.

What local considerations should I keep in mind for Audi maintenance in Walling's climate?

The humid summers and cold winters make more frequent cabin air filter changes advisable for air quality and system protection. Also, ensure your service includes checking for moisture-related electrical gremlins and that your cooling system and battery are tested rigorously before seasonal extremes.
